GaN+ Technology Explained—Why Size Doesn't Determine Power
What Gallium Nitride Technology Is and How It Differs
Gallium Nitride represents a fundamental departure from the silicon-based chargers that have dominated the market for years. Traditional chargers rely on silicon transistors that require larger components to handle the same power levels, which explains why your old laptop charger was the size of a brick. GaN+ technology compresses that functionality into a fraction of the space by using semiconductors that operate more efficiently at higher frequencies.
The practical upshot? AOHI engineered the Magcube 100W to deliver the same power output as chargers three times its size. You're not sacrificing performance for portability—you're getting both through smarter engineering.
Energy Efficiency Gains and Heat Reduction
GaN+ chargers convert electrical power with greater efficiency, meaning less energy wasted as heat. The Magcube 100W maintains safe operating temperatures even during sustained heavy use, which extends the charger's lifespan and protects your devices. This efficiency also means lower electricity consumption, which adds up if you're charging multiple devices daily.
Heat reduction is particularly important for travel scenarios where you might be charging in confined spaces like airplane seats or hotel rooms. The Magcube stays cool enough to place on sensitive surfaces without concern.
Compact Footprint and Weight Considerations
Measuring just 2.36" × 2.36" × 1.26", the Magcube 100W fits comfortably in a jacket pocket or small carry-on compartment. At 0.44 lbs, it's light enough that you won't notice it in your bag, yet powerful enough to charge your most demanding devices. The foldable prongs add another layer of convenience for travelers, reducing the overall footprint even further when packed.

Dual USB-C Ports and Intelligent Power Distribution
How the Magcube Allocates 100W Across Two Devices
The two USB-C ports on the Magcube 100W don't simply split the available power in half. Instead, they incorporate intelligent power allocation that recognizes what you're charging and distributes watts accordingly. If you plug in a MacBook Pro and an iPhone simultaneously, the charger automatically sends more power to the laptop while still delivering rapid charging to your phone.
This isn't a gimmick—it's a practical solution to the reality that different devices have different power requirements. A MacBook Pro can accept up to 100W, while an iPhone charges optimally at 20-30W. The Magcube's technology handles this automatically.
Charging Scenarios: 65W + 30W vs. 50W + 50W
Real-world scenarios demonstrate the flexibility of this approach. When charging a 16-inch MacBook Pro alongside an iPhone, the Magcube typically allocates 65W to the laptop and 30W to the phone. Both charge significantly faster than they would with standard chargers, and the phone reaches full capacity while the laptop is still charging.
If you're charging two laptops or two tablets with similar power demands, the system distributes 50W to each port. This balanced approach ensures neither device experiences throttled charging speeds.

Charging Speed Performance Across Device Categories
MacBook Pro 16-Inch Charging Times
The headline performance metric: a 16-inch MacBook Pro charges to full capacity in approximately 1.8 hours using the Magcube 100W. That's substantially faster than the standard 87W charger Apple provides, and drastically faster than legacy chargers. For professionals working with resource-intensive applications, this matters—a quick lunch break can restore your laptop to full capacity.
This speed is consistent across multiple charge cycles, indicating the charger maintains performance stability over time.
iPad Pro and Tablet Charging
iPad Pro models support up to 35W fast charging, and the Magcube 100W delivers that without hesitation. An 11-inch iPad Pro reaches full charge in roughly 2.5 hours, while the 12.9-inch model completes charging in approximately 3 hours. These times represent meaningful improvements over standard iPad chargers.
For tablet users who rely on their devices for work, these charging speeds eliminate the scenario where your iPad is still at 30% when you need to leave.
iPhone 13/14 Series Rapid Charging Performance
iPhones in the 13 and 14 series support up to 27W fast charging. The Magcube 100W delivers this optimally, taking approximately 30 minutes to reach 50% capacity and roughly 1.5 hours for a full charge. These figures align with Apple's official fast-charging specifications, confirming the Magcube delivers legitimate performance.
When paired with the included LED display cable, you can watch the charging wattage in real-time and verify you're receiving optimal fast-charging speeds.
Galaxy S21/S22 and Android Device Compatibility
Samsung's flagship phones support similar fast-charging specifications as iPhones, and the Magcube 100W handles them flawlessly. The S21 and S22 series reach full charge in approximately 1.5 hours, with 50% capacity achieved in roughly 25-30 minutes.

The LED Display Cable—Transparency in Charging Power
What the 4-Foot USB-C Cable Shows You
The included 4-foot (1.2m) USB-C to USB-C cable features an integrated LED digital display that shows real-time wattage flowing between the charger and your device. This transparency is unusual in the charging accessory market and adds genuine value to the package.
The display illuminates to show the exact power delivery—whether you're charging at 20W, 65W, or the full 100W. For users who want verification that their devices are receiving optimal charging speeds, this eliminates guesswork.

Safety Features and Thermal Management
Multiple Protection Layers
The Magcube 100W incorporates multiple independent protection systems. Over-current protection prevents excessive current from damaging your devices. Over-voltage protection stops the charger from delivering voltages above safe levels. Over-heating detection shuts down power delivery if internal temperatures exceed safe thresholds. Short-circuit protection prevents catastrophic failures if something goes wrong.
These protections work simultaneously, creating layered defense that catches problems at different levels. It's not just a single safety mechanism—it's comprehensive protection.
Heat Generation During Heavy Use
During sustained heavy charging of multiple devices, the Magcube 100W generates some warmth. This is normal and expected with high-power chargers. However, GaN+ technology keeps heat generation substantially lower than silicon-based chargers handling the same power levels.
Users report the charger reaching approximately 45-50°C (113-122°F) during continuous heavy use—warm to the touch but well within safe operating temperatures. Internal components are rated for significantly higher temperatures, providing a substantial safety margin.

Price-to-Performance Analysis and Value Proposition
$85.99 Positioning Within the GaN Charger Market
At $85.99, the Magcube 100W sits in the premium segment of the GaN charger market. You can find 65W GaN chargers for $50-60, and budget 100W chargers without the advanced features for around $70. The Magcube's price reflects its comprehensive feature set and brand backing.
However, the market context matters. High-quality 100W GaN chargers from established brands typically price in the $80-100 range. The Magcube 100W is competitively positioned, not overpriced.
Cost Comparison Against Buying Multiple Single-Device Chargers
This is where the real value emerges. A quality MacBook charger costs $40-50. An iPhone fast charger costs $20-30. An iPad charger costs $30-40. If you're purchasing separate chargers for each device, you're spending $90-120 easily.
The Magcube 100W replaces all three with a single $85.99 purchase. Financially, it pays for itself by consolidating chargers.

The Honest Drawbacks and Limitations
Slight Warmth During Sustained Heavy-Load Charging
During extended simultaneous charging of two high-power devices, the Magcube 100W becomes noticeably warm. While this warmth remains within safe operating parameters, it's worth acknowledging. Users sensitive to heat or those charging in confined spaces might find this concerning, even if it poses no actual safety risk.
The warmth dissipates quickly once you stop charging both devices simultaneously, suggesting it's a transient issue rather than a fundamental design flaw.
Premium Pricing Compared to Lower-Wattage Alternatives
At $85.99, the Magcube 100W costs more than 65W chargers and significantly more than 30W chargers. If your needs truly require only 30W of power, the premium features don't justify the extra expense. The cost is legitimate for users whose devices genuinely demand high power, but it's excessive for others.
This isn't a design flaw—it's simply reality that premium features cost more. The question is whether you need those features.
Single-Charger Dependency and Backup Considerations
Consolidating all your charging into one device creates a single point of failure. If the Magcube malfunctions, you lose charging capability for all your devices simultaneously. Smart users consider maintaining a backup charger, particularly business professionals who depend on reliable charging.
This is a limitation of the consolidation approach itself, not a specific flaw in the Magcube 100W.
Cable Length Constraints for Certain Desk Setups
The included 4-foot cable is practical for travel and general use but may feel short for permanent desktop setups where you want your charger across the room on a power strip. Users with specific desk configurations might need longer cables, requiring separate purchases.
AOHI offers longer cables separately, but this adds to the total investment if you need extended length.
Port Placement and Potential Cable Congestion
With the ports positioned on a single face of the charger, charging two devices simultaneously can result in cables interfering with each other, particularly with bulkier devices or right-angled connectors. The compact size that makes the Magcube 100W portable comes with the tradeoff of slightly tighter port spacing.
This is a minor inconvenience that affects some users more than others depending on their specific device configurations.
